2003 Sedan with sport suspension and nav. Bought brand new in May 2002 original owner.
136k miles so far without any major engine or transmission problems so far.
Had some minor issues such as the climate control and radio going out which I replaced with a JDM DD.
Oil consumption is up from before. A little over 1 liter per 1000 miles.

ive got 120k and kept up on all regular maintenance, run strong like the day i bought it
the only major problems ive had are my cam position sensor & my tensioner pulley...
ive replaced the sensor no problem around 100k but the pulley is a recent problem
the bearing on the tensioner pulley is about to go and my car squeaks off and on, more so when i first start it in the day or after highway driving.
love the VQ35DE though, wonderful motor.
has anyone else ran into the tensioner pulley problem??

2005 G35x, I have 102,xxx on the odo. So far i've had all my belts, brake pads and front rotors replaced. Just recently my CD changer died so all of my discs are now stuck. My front passenger door actuator just went out south and will need to be replaced soon.
I do notice that in the past year the power is not as immediate as before. All in all the car is pretty rock solid. I will definitely look to upgrade to another G in the near future.
